FUN COMPETITION!

During the week beginning 10th August we are holding a Fun FLAG Competition which can be entered on any day of the week, between Monday 10th and Sunday 16th August.    Just book a time as usual with anyone you want, they do not need to play in the competition if they don't want to, but will need to keep a check on your cumulative score.
This will be a non counting 'Flag' competition, played on the Green Course and is open to all categories of members.  You can enter over 18 holes or over 9 holes but must enter on How Did I Do on the day you are playing - before beginning your round.

Instructions are very simple:-
1.  You have a maximum number of strokes to use so you keep your cumulative total as you play, as well as your total for each hole.  If your handicap for 18 holes is 28, add that to 74 -the par for 18 holes- which gives you 102 strokes.
2.  Maximum of 10 strokes per hole.  Pick up and move on recording a 10 if necessary.
3.  Once all your strokes have been used, note accurately where your ball has finished and on which hole, or take a picture.
This could be "just off the back of the 17th green " or "in the bunker at right hand side of 18th green" etc.
4.  If you complete 18 holes and have strokes left over, that is what you record.

Exactly the same principle applies to playing 9 holes - Start at the 1st but don't start scoring until the 4th hole and play until the 12th.  Your number of strokes will be your 9 hole handicap added to 37, which is the par for the 9 holes.
